Pages

Pascal's Triangle - Pattern Pascal's Triangle in C Programming

Tuesday 9 July 2013
Pascal's Triangle 

This is a triangular array of binomial coefficients. This program is entry value for the lines of Pascal's triangle.
Come element specific place by adding top level (above) to the left value and the right value ....


#include<stdio.h>
#include<conio.h>

void main()
{
    int a,i,j,k;
    int num;
    clrscr();
   
    printf("\n Enter number of rows for pascal's triangle: ");
    scanf("%d",&num);
    printf("\n\t******PASCAL'S TRIANGLE******\n\n");

    for(i=0;i<num;i++)
    {
        a = 1;
        for(j=0;j<num-i;j++)
        {
            printf("   ");
        }
        for(k = 0;k<=i;k++)
        {
               printf("   ");
               printf("%d",a);
               printf(" ");
               a = a * (i - k) / (k + 1);
          }
          printf("\n");
          printf("\n");
     }
     printf("\n");
     getch();
}

No comments:

Post a Comment